About the Indiana Department of Revenue (DOR):
The Indiana Department of Revenue has served Indiana, its population, and the business community since 1947. Our more than 700 dedicated team members administer over 65 different tax types and annually process nearly $30 billion of tax revenue. We are a Top Workplace employer.
Role Overview:
The Communications Consultant plans, develops, writes, and publishes a variety of content, including business letters, guides, newsletters, and website and social media content. You will collaborate with subject matter experts to ensure content is accurate and targeted to help better support internal and external communication needs. The Communications Consultant will be part of a highly cooperative team that works closely with other creative and business focused teams, ensuing content aligns with the strategic vision, goals, and culture of the agency.
Salary:
This position starts at an annual salary of $59,800 and may be commensurate with education and job experience.
